    Hi,
    The relevant transaction in OBA1 for the bank accounts is KDF.
    Double click on KDF, a new screen will open up, where you do the following:
    You enter the bank GL account here.  If the account is to be differently handled at the level of the currency and currency type then you can further limit the exchange rate difference based on these 2 parameters.
    Once you have entered the bank GL, save and then double click the bank GL account.  A new screen will open up where you define accounts for the following:
    The accounts below will carry the forex gain loss that you when you clear foreign currency transactions.
    1.  Exchange Rate difference realised:
    Loss                 XXXXXX
    Gain                 YYYYY
    The accounts below will carry the difference while valuating you open items for
    2.  Valuation:
    Val.loss 1           XXXXXX
    Val.gain 1           YYYYY
    Bal.sheet adj.1      ZZZZZZ
    The accounts below will carry transaltion losses.
    3.  Translation
    Loss
    Bal.sheet adj.loss
    Gain
    Bal.sheet adj.gain

  • IMPORT CONDITION TYPES AND ITS RATE?

    In the following condition types used in IMPORT which are all Cenvatable and as on date what is the TAX Rate?
    JCDB IN:Basic Custom Duty
    JCV1 IN : CVD
    JECV IN : Ed Cess on CVD
    J1CV IN : H&SECess on CVD
    JEDB IN : Ed Cess on BCD
    JSDB IN : H&SECess on BCD
    JADC Addnl Duty of Custom

    Hi,
    JCDB IN:Basic Custom Duty - Non Cenvatable ( gets inventorised)
    JCV1 IN : CVD - Cenvatable can be used against
    JECV IN : Ed Cess on CVD -- Cenvatable
    J1CV IN : H&SECess on CVD - Cenvatable
    JEDB IN : Ed Cess on BCD - Non Cenvatable ( gets inventorised)
    JSDB IN : H&SECess on BCD- Non Cenvatable ( gets inventorised)
    JADC Addnl Duty of Custom- Cenvatable as per Excise Law
    Above mentioned all Cenvatable duties can be setoff against FG Duty Liability.
    One more thing , in some of the state like Pant Nagar , if your client is having a plant and has opted for duty exepmtion, all the above duties will be treated as Non Cenvatable.

  • How are US tax condition types XR1 to XR6 calculated

    i searched few forums to understand the ways of US taxes getting claculated particularly on condition types XR1 to XR6, is the value available in SAP system or is the percentage value maintained in the taxware or vertex system?
    if in SAP where is this maintained, i could see the same input & output tax codes assigned in OBCL settings for many states in US, so i am not able to relate this in FTXP, as different states provide different calculation.
    if it is maintained through external system, is there way we can check the values or see in the screen?, how is this link of checking the external system enabled, is it through 301 cal type & its associated function module,
    will there be a chance to change this value from the user end or do we need to seek Taxware or Vertex assistance here.
    sorry on too many questions.
    just got confused with the way it works
    Regards
    Ilango

    Hi Ilango,
    Check my responses to your respective questions:
    i searched few forums to understand the ways of US taxes getting claculated particularly on condition types XR1 to XR6, is the value available in SAP system or is the percentage value maintained in the taxware or vertex system?
    In SAP, only Condition Type XR1 to XR6 are only condition which is responsible for computation of tax in US & Canada. Where, even condition types UTXD & UTXE are equally essential to this. These condition types used for external tax calculation.
    if in SAP where is this maintained, i could see the same input & output tax codes assigned in OBCL settings for many states in US, so i am not able to relate this in FTXP, as different states provide different calculation.
    Well, I don't think there much from SD side to explorer here. As Tax procedure hardly have any role to play in SD business process for tax rate determination. But, that is very significant from GL Account determination for respective Tax Transaction in SD.
    Refer my posts on
    Tax code and SAP SD - ERP Operations - SCN Wiki
    Plant-wise Different Tax General Ledger Accounts - ERP Operations - SCN Wiki
    Whereas, configuration for Non-Taxable transaction as maintained in TCode OBCL, generally comes in picture when Tax Jurisdiction is not maintained in respective Ship-to master. Based on that configuration system will determine Tax Jurisdiction for those Ship-to.
    % are maintained in FV11, not in FTXP.
    if it is maintained through external system, is there way we can check the values or see in the screen?, how is this link of checking the external system enabled, is it through 301 cal type & its associated function module,
    301 is not the only Routine associated. As like UTXD & UTXE there respective routines 500(collect tax input - export to IVP) & 501(get tax output data - import from IVP) are equally important with others 301 to 306(Set tax values and percentage into condition structure and fill tax base amount based on FM  GET_TAX_RESULTS_FOR_301_306)
    Refer SCN Wiki Tax jurisdiction - ERP SD - SCN Wiki
    will there be a chance to change this value from the user end or do we need to seek Taxware or Vertex assistance here.
    Hope you are aware, these tax IVPs are tool that is used to calculate taxes for the US tax rules.Yes, you might need to ask respective Tax IVP.
    In Taxware, it provides the tax jurisdictions codes for master data addresses in SAP. Based on combination of both tax jurisdictions, the Taxware product code and dates, Taxware returns rates and amounts of tax and which jurisdictions get the tax.
